Is 322 217 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 322 217 is about 567.642.

Thus, the square root of 322 217 is not an integer, and therefore 322 217 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 322 217?

The square of a number (here 322 217) is the result of the product of this number (322 217) by itself (i.e., 322 217 × 322 217); the square of 322 217 is sometimes called "raising 322 217 to the power 2", or "322 217 squared".

The square of 322 217 is 103 823 795 089 because 322 217 × 322 217 = 322 2172 = 103 823 795 089.

As a consequence, 322 217 is the square root of 103 823 795 089.
